Bon Iver To Debut New Album At Eaux Claires
. ![]()
(Radio.com) More than five years have passed since Bon Iver fans heard a new studio album. The indie folk band's last release Bon Iver, Bon Iver came out in 2011 and won the band (fronted by Justin Vernon) a Best New Artist Grammy. Despite dabbling in collaborations and other material in the subsequent years, the follow-up to that self-titled breakthrough has been long elusive. Now, it looks like the band will premiere its next album at the Eaux Claires festival in Wisconsin this Friday. Last month Bon Iver shared a cryptic YouTube video tagged "22 Days," which many interpreted to signal an impending release, reports Billboard. Read more here.
